So here is my problem :
I'm using Linux (Xubuntu) and have install Subsonic.

But cannot complete my configuration.

If I check the "using UPnP or NAT-PMP port forwarding" in my router the port forwarding is ok but the http://my_adress.subsonic.org didn't work (connection timeout it said)
If I don't check the bok, setup manualy my IP and open port 4040 and 80 as portforward.com explain me, the http://my_adress.subsonic.org work but I've receiving au "Status : No router found"

After checking the port 4040 is really open but not the port 80.

I don't know what to do, somebody can help me ?

If it is working then you do not have a problem.
You can ignore the router not found message as you are manually forwarding the port.
All that is saying is java cannot find your router in its database for auto port forwarding purposes.
With regard to port 80 you do not need that open as you are using 4040.
(Portforward.com says you do - they are wrong)
